ChatGPT消息一點(diǎn)一點(diǎn)輸出是怎么做到的?
ChatGPT消息一點(diǎn)一點(diǎn)輸出是通過對(duì)話的交互式方式實(shí)現(xiàn)的。當(dāng)用戶發(fā)送消息后,ChatGPT會(huì)逐步生成回復(fù),并將部分回復(fù)內(nèi)容逐漸顯示給用戶。這種逐步輸出的機(jī)制可以增加對(duì)話的流暢性和用戶體驗(yàn)。
在技術(shù)上,這種逐步輸出可以通過以下方式實(shí)現(xiàn):
文本生成控制:ChatGPT可以生成一小段文本作為回復(fù)的開始,然后逐漸擴(kuò)展該文本,生成更多的內(nèi)容。逐步輸出可以通過控制文本生成的長(zhǎng)度和速度來實(shí)現(xiàn)。
延遲響應(yīng):ChatGPT可以將部分回復(fù)內(nèi)容發(fā)送給用戶,然后在一段時(shí)間后繼續(xù)生成剩余的回復(fù)。這樣用戶可以先看到部分回復(fù)內(nèi)容,而不是等待全部生成完畢后再顯示。
逐步加載:在一些用戶界面或應(yīng)用程序中,逐步輸出可以通過逐步加載消息的方式實(shí)現(xiàn)。即使ChatGPT已經(jīng)生成完整的回復(fù),但系統(tǒng)可能會(huì)選擇逐步將回復(fù)的各個(gè)部分發(fā)送給用戶,以達(dá)到逐步輸出的效果。
需要注意的是,逐步輸出的速度和方式可能因應(yīng)用程序或平臺(tái)的不同而有所變化。有些應(yīng)用程序可能更傾向于快速生成完整回復(fù),而有些應(yīng)用程序可能更傾向于逐步輸出以實(shí)現(xiàn)更好的用戶體驗(yàn)。
標(biāo)簽: